MACH hub convert from 1" to 1.25"
Going to a XZ drive w/1.25" prop shaft. My MACH props all have 1"
hubs Can the rubber hub be pressed out and replaced w/1.25" ? Or what is the best plan of attack?

It can be done. It's much easier and cheaper with a front load hub than it is with a rear load hub.
Meaning, if the hub is pressed from the aft end of the prop it is more difficult to instal a large hub shaft than it is with a front load hub.
